Sentencing has been set for June 18 for a former Hopkinton police officer found guilty on Friday in connection to sexual encounters he had with a student when he was a school resource officer 20 years ago. On Friday a jury found John Porter guilty of three counts of child rape following a three-day trial. The judge revoked his bail and ordered him to stay in custody until he is sentenced. Porter, who had pleaded not guilty, did not testify. Porter had been with the Hopkinton Police Department for more than 30 years.
